Transaction 73ce005683b6c7e2f5efbf0d95dcdf2b16b6e84c47d0162034514620bb996e94

1 Input
2 Outputs
  • 73ce005683b6c7e2f5efbf0d95dcdf2b16b6e84c47d0162034514620bb996e94:0
  • value  50000000
    address  3AKy5n9h1SfXXRRQifffmpyLdGG9QBankd
  • 73ce005683b6c7e2f5efbf0d95dcdf2b16b6e84c47d0162034514620bb996e94:1
  • value  2181205312
    address  35BSYWhC4qezcxXaHp8pPvCuiAh8aXW52i